The Rise of Niche Digital Collectibles

Unlike mainstream collectibles, niche digital assets such as pirots serve targeted communities with shared interests, often combining elements of gaming, art, and social interaction. Industry data show that from 2020 to 2023, niche NFT projects have consistently outperformed broader markets in user engagement, with some niche categories experiencing growth rates exceeding 150%. This trend underscores a demand for community-driven, authentic experiences that mainstream markets may overlook.

Technological Enablers and Market Insights

Aspect Details & Industry Insights
Blockchain Platforms Most pirots are hosted on Ethereum or Binance Smart Chain, ensuring transparent provenance and secure ownership transfer.
Community Engagement Platforms like Discord, Telegram, and specialized forums foster active interaction, essential for niche project growth.
Market Trends Niche collections often experience “hype cycles” driven by community influencers, with some appreciating 300% in value within months.
Authenticity & Rarity Rarity tiers and limited editions increase desirability, prompting secondary markets and valuation spikes.
